The Science Behind Late-Night Eating and Your Body Clock

Your Circadian Rhythm and Metabolism

Your body operates on an internal 24-hour clock known as the circadian rhythm, which dictates your sleep-wake cycles, hormone releases, and metabolic processes. Typically, your metabolism is most active during daylight hours and slows down as you approach rest, priming your body for sleep. Eating late at night, especially after 10 p.m., forces your digestive system to work overtime when it's supposed to be resting. Research shows this misalignment can cause a lower metabolic rate and a shift in how your body processes nutrients. Instead of efficiently using calories for energy, the body is more prone to storing them as fat, which can contribute to weight gain over time.

Hormonal Disruption: Hunger and Satiety

Late-night eating directly impacts the hormones that regulate your appetite, ghrelin and leptin. Ghrelin is the 'hunger hormone' that signals to your brain that it's time to eat, while leptin is the 'fullness hormone' that signals satiety. Studies have found that late eaters can have higher levels of ghrelin and lower levels of leptin. This hormonal imbalance can create a vicious cycle, where eating late makes you hungrier the next day, leading to increased overall calorie consumption and cravings for unhealthy foods. This dysregulation also contributes to why many late-night snackers report skipping breakfast the next morning, further throwing their metabolism out of sync.

Metabolic Consequences of Eating After Midnight

Increased Risk of Weight Gain

When you eat past midnight, you often add extra, unnecessary calories to your total daily intake. Because your metabolism is less efficient at night, these additional calories are more likely to be stored as fat. Compounded with poor sleep and imbalanced hunger hormones, late-night snacking can lead to a consistent calorie surplus that results in gradual, long-term weight gain. It's not that calories magically count for more at night; rather, the combination of timing and typically poor food choices (like high-fat or sugary snacks) creates a perfect storm for weight gain.

Impaired Blood Sugar Control

Multiple studies have linked late-night eating to impaired glucose tolerance and reduced insulin sensitivity, which are precursors to type 2 diabetes. A study comparing the effects of a late dinner (10:00 p.m.) versus a routine dinner (6:00 p.m.) in healthy volunteers found that the late dinner resulted in higher glucose and insulin levels the following morning. This suggests that eating late forces your body to handle food during a period when it is less metabolically prepared, increasing the strain on your system over time. Overlapping the postprandial (after-eating) period with your sleep phase is metabolically inefficient and can promote insulin resistance if it becomes a habit.

How Your Digestive System Reacts

Digestive Discomfort and Acid Reflux

Eating a large meal or a rich snack and then lying down shortly after is a primary cause of digestive discomfort. Gravity no longer helps keep stomach acid where it belongs, increasing the risk of acid reflux and heartburn. This can cause a burning sensation in your chest and throat, nausea, and a general feeling of unease that disrupts your ability to rest comfortably. Chronic or frequent acid reflux can also contribute to gastroesophageal reflux disease (GERD) over time.

Slower Digestion and Nutrient Processing

During sleep, your gastrointestinal tract slows down to aid in the body's repair and recovery processes. The production of digestive enzymes and the movement of food through your intestines decrease. When you eat late, your body is forced to divert energy and resources toward digesting food rather than the restorative processes that should be taking place. This can lead to issues like bloating, indigestion, and inefficient nutrient absorption, leaving you feeling heavy and uncomfortable upon waking.

Impact on Sleep Quality

Late-night eating is a known cause of sleep disturbance, often leading to fragmented, lower-quality rest. The act of digesting food elevates your body temperature and metabolic rate, which can interfere with your body's natural transition into a restful state. Eating high-carbohydrate or high-fat meals close to bedtime can cause blood sugar spikes followed by crashes, which can cause you to wake up in the middle of the night. Poor sleep is also linked to poorer food choices and increased cravings the next day, fueling a cycle of unhealthy eating.

Strategies to Address Late-Night Hunger

If you find yourself constantly hungry after hours, consider these proactive strategies:

  • Balance your daytime meals: Ensure you are consuming enough calories and nutrients throughout the day, including adequate protein, fat, and fiber, to prevent evening cravings.
  • Stay hydrated: Sometimes your body mistakes thirst for hunger. Try drinking a glass of water or herbal tea before you reach for a snack.
  • Mindful eating: Before you eat, pause and consider if you are truly hungry or if you are eating out of boredom, stress, or habit.
  • Plan a light, healthy snack: If you genuinely need a snack, choose something small and nutrient-dense, such as a handful of almonds, a banana with nut butter, or plain yogurt.
  • Create new nighttime habits: Instead of snacking, engage in a relaxing activity like reading, listening to music, or meditating to help your body and mind wind down for sleep.
